Brazil Plans 2.3-Billion-Real AI Supercomputers in Two Sites
x/nvidia
— Aug 20, 2026
Brazil is investing about 2.3 billion reais ($444 million) to build two AI supercomputers, splitting the funds between Huawei/iFlytek in Rio de Janeiro and a Nvidia-led project in Rio Grande do Norte to diversify suppliers and boost technological autonomy. The funding, drawn from the National Fund for Scientific and Technological Development, aims to strengthen data sovereignty and balance ties with the US and China by pursuing both Chinese and American technology partnerships.
